Chapter 3 - Chapter 3: Meeting Seto Kaiba

The duel platform slowly descended. Kisaragi walked up to Yamamoto, smiling.

"Then I'll be counting on you to cover everything I spend here today."

"Damn you, you nasty woman!" Yamamoto lurched to his feet and reached out, trying to grab her by the throat.

Kisaragi was startled. She stumbled back—and fell onto the floor.

Just as Yamamoto's hand was about to touch her, a card came flying through the air and drove itself deep into his hand.

"AAAGH—!" Yamamoto screamed, clutching it. "It hurts! Who ambushed me?!"

"Hmph. Pathetic."

The crowd split down the middle. A tall figure walked forward through the path they made—calm, cold, and commanding.

Seto Kaiba.

"You lose a duel and then try to assault someone? You're not worthy of calling yourself a duelist."

"Y-You're… Seto Kaiba!" Yamamoto blurted out.

At that moment, the arcade owner rushed over, practically tripping over himself to greet Kaiba.

"President Kaiba! If we'd known you were coming, we would've—"

"Throw this man out," Kaiba said icily. "And clear the building. I want to speak to this woman alone."

"Y-Yes! Right away!"

Within moments, Yamamoto was hauled out by security. The other customers were hurriedly ushered outside. A sign was hung on the door:

TEMPORARILY CLOSED

Kaiba stepped up behind Kisaragi.

"Are you alright?"

Kisaragi stood, dusted off her clothes, and turned to face him.

"I'm fine. I was just startled."

Now that Kaiba could see her clearly, his heart slammed against his ribs. His breathing grew heavy. He hunched forward and clutched his head.

A vivid image flooded his mind—

A priest, kneeling before a stone wall carved with Blue-Eyes White Dragon, holding the body of a silver-haired woman.

And that woman's face was identical to the girl standing in front of him now.

"You okay?" Kisaragi asked—deliberately.

She knew exactly what her appearance would do to him.

"I'm fine," Kaiba said, forcing himself upright. His gaze locked onto her. "What's your name?"

"Kisaragi Aoi."

"Kisaragi… Kisaragi…" Kaiba murmured the name as if tasting something painfully familiar.

("Kisaragi" is the romanization of the surname 如月—and its pronunciation closely resembles "Kisara.")

"My name is Seto Kaiba," he said at last. "President of KaibaCorp. I watched your duel. It was impressive. And you possess Blue-Eyes White Dragon."

He opened a sleek briefcase.

"I'll trade you these cards for your Blue-Eyes White Dragon. Name your price—whatever you want."

"I refuse," Kisaragi said without hesitation.

"What?" Kaiba's brow tightened.

"Blue-Eyes White Dragon is precious to me. No card, and no amount of money, can compare to it."

As she spoke, Kisaragi remembered her previous life—her first true ace monster had been Blue-Eyes White Dragon. Even after she moved on to other powerhouses, Blue-Eyes had remained irreplaceable.

Nearby, the arcade owner looked like his heart might jump out of his mouth.

He'd never seen anyone refuse Kaiba—ever.

But Kaiba didn't get angry.

He wasn't displeased at all.

In fact… he felt strangely pleased.

And more than that—when he watched her command Blue-Eyes, he didn't feel the slightest anger at someone else wielding "his" dragon.

It felt… natural. As if it had always been that way.

"Then we'll use ante rules," Kaiba said.

"A duel?" Kisaragi asked.

"Exactly. If I win, you hand over that Blue-Eyes White Dragon. If you win, you get every card in this briefcase—and I'll offer you a position at KaibaCorp."

Even if she wins… I still want her to stay, Kaiba thought. Everything in me is screaming that I have to keep this woman by my side. If I let her go, I'll regret it for the rest of my life.

"Fine," Kisaragi said, stepping back onto the duel platform.

A job at KaibaCorp would make things easier down the line, she thought. Even if that company is basically a disaster magnet later on.

"Then it's settled." Kaiba stepped onto the opposite platform and placed his deck.

DUEL!

Kisaragi Aoi: LP 4000

Seto Kaiba: LP 4000

"President Kaiba, I'll take the first move," Kisaragi said.

"Come," Kaiba replied.

"I Normal Summon Holy Knight of the Great Dragon in Attack Position!"

A blond, red-eyed knight wielding curved blades appeared on Kisaragi's field.

Holy Knight of the Great Dragon (ATK 1700 / DEF 300)

"I activate its effect. When this card is Normal or Special Summoned, I can equip it with a Level 7 or Level 8 Dragon from my hand or Deck as an Equip Card."

She pulled a card from her Deck and placed it into her Spell/Trap Zone behind the knight.

"I equip Blue-Eyes White Dragon to Holy Knight of the Great Dragon!"

Equipping Blue-Eyes…? What is she planning? Kaiba's eyes narrowed.

"I set two cards. End my turn."

(Cards in hand: 3)

"Your move, President Kaiba," Kisaragi said with a sweet smile.

"My turn—draw!"

"I Normal Summon Kaiser Sea Horse in Attack Position!"

Kaiser Sea Horse (ATK 1700 / DEF 1650)

"Same 1700 Attack," Kisaragi said. "President Kaiba, are you trying to trade blows and take us both down?"

"Don't say something so stupid," Kaiba snapped, slapping a card onto the field.

"I activate the Spell Card Double Summon! This turn, I can conduct one additional Normal Summon."

"…So that means—" Kisaragi's gaze sharpened.

"Hmph. When Kaiser Sea Horse is used to Tribute Summon a LIGHT monster, it can be treated as two tributes."

He lifted his hand like a blade.

"I Tribute Kaiser Sea Horse—then I Tribute Summon Blue-Eyes White Dragon in Attack Position!"

"Appear—my soul… and my pride… Blue-Eyes White Dragon!"

The white dragon erupted onto Kaiba's field. In that moment, Kaiba looked like a true dragon tamer—utterly fearless as he commanded the titan before him.

As expected of Kaiba, Kisaragi thought. He drops Blue-Eyes on the first turn.

"Battle!"

"Blue-Eyes White Dragon, attack Holy Knight of the Great Dragon—Burst Stream of Destruction!"

A blast of white light engulfed the knight.

Kisaragi Aoi: LP 4000 → 2700

"Tsk… President Kaiba really doesn't believe in going easy on women," Kisaragi said—and flipped a card.

"I activate the Trap Card Drone Hunter! When one of my monsters is destroyed by battle and sent to the Graveyard, I gain Life Points equal to the destroyed monster's original Attack."

"Holy Knight of the Great Dragon has 1700 Attack, so I gain 1700 Life Points!"

Kisaragi Aoi: LP 2700 → 4400

Kaiba's eyes flicked to the card Kisaragi had equipped earlier.

"However," he said, "since Holy Knight of the Great Dragon was destroyed, the equipped Blue-Eyes White Dragon is sent to the Graveyard."

He placed one card face-down.

"I set one card. End my turn."

(Cards in hand: 3)
